Story Behind the Song
Author, Caroline Myss, Ph.D., writes in The Three Levels of Power, that to Honor Who You Are is one the most powerful messages we can give to ourselves. I wrote this song on the Winter Solstice in 1999 (12/21) and attribute the positive life changing shifts that have occurred in my life since then to my surrendering to absolute resonance with these words. Embracing change is a courageous act that truly takes us fast and far. This version of the song was chosen for the Maui AIDS Benefit CD in 2001, produced by the Maui organization, "Dream To Make A Difference".
